Polymers of intrinsic microporosity (PIMs), as novel microporous organic polymers polymerized by rigid monomers that have sites of contortion, have great application potential in homogeneous catalysis and hydrogen storage due to their high specific surface, chemical and physical stability and pore size controllability. Particularly, PIMs composed of polymer chains attract more attention in gas separation membranes due to their superior gas separation properties and good solubility. Here, the classification and applications of PIMs as well as the properties including stability, gas permeability and gas selectivity of PIMs gas membrane are introduced. The structure controls and modifications of PIMs gas membrane and the relationship between molecular structures and gas separation properties are described in detail. Finally, the problems existed in the present research are pointed out and a brief comment on the development is given.
